
The club has extended its free catering services to the Carinyena Health Centre and the Centro de Tecnifiación Deportiva
Villarreal CF has added the Carinyena Health Centre and the Centro de Tecnifiación Deportiva in Vila-real to the #CuentaConmigo (Count on Me) campaign. To thank them for their hard work in the fight against COVID-19, the club has extended its free catering services to the local health centre, as well as the sports facility, which has become a secondary facility to help combat the pandemic. The club already regularly provides meals for the La Plana hospital in Vila-real and the Miltary Emergencies Unit.
The #CuentaConmigo initiative, led by the club, the men’s first team and the Fundación Carlos Bacca, also provides meals for families with scarce recourses and those at risk of social exclusion by preparing 200 daily meals at the Estadio de la Cerámica. These meals are given to Cáritas Vila-real for distribution among those more disadvantaged who are affected by the coronavirus pandemic.
The club’s sponsor Coca-Cola has shown its support for the campaign, donating 200 cans of the soft drink to be provided to those most vulnerable and healthcare staff, who are fighting for our health in these tough times.
